Mobile computing in medical education: opportunities and challenges
Larry F Chu1, Matthew J Erlendson, John S Sun
1Department of Anesthesia, Stanford University School of Medicine, Stanford, California 94305-5640, USA. lchu@stanford.edu
Mobile devices are increasingly vital in academic medicine for physicians, residents, and students. While beneficial for education and patient care, challenges like privacy and connectivity must be addressed for successful integration.

Background:
- Mobile computing devices are increasingly prevalent among healthcare professionals.
- Physicians, residents, and medical students widely use mobile devices for various professional tasks.
Purpose of the Study:
- To assess the current opportunities and challenges of mobile computing in the academic medical environment.
- To understand the feasibility and benefits of mobile device integration for academic medical institutions.
Main Methods:
- Literature review of current research on mobile device usage in academic medicine.
- Analysis of studies examining the effectiveness and challenges of mobile technology in healthcare education and practice.
Main Results:
- A majority of physicians, residents, and medical students own or utilize mobile devices.
- Mobile devices are effective educational tools, clinical resource guides, and aids for bedside patient care.
- Key challenges include privacy concerns, connectivity issues, standardization, and maintaining professionalism.
Conclusions:
- Mobile computing offers significant opportunities for enhancing medical education and patient care.
- Addressing deployment challenges is crucial for realizing the full potential of mobile devices in academic medicine.
- Understanding these factors aids institutions in determining the benefits and feasibility of mobile technology adoption.
